From: Andreas Larsson <andreas@gaisler.com>

[ Upstream commit 66d0f7ec9f1038452178b1993fc07fd96d30fd38 ]

Load balancing can be triggered in the critical sections protected by
srmmu_context_spinlock in destroy_context() and switch_mm() and can hang
the cpu waiting for the rq lock of another cpu that in turn has called
switch_mm hangning on srmmu_context_spinlock leading to deadlock.

So, disable interrupt while taking srmmu_context_spinlock in
destroy_context() and switch_mm() so we don't deadlock.

See also commit 77b838fa1ef0 ("[SPARC64]: destroy_context() needs to disable
interrupts.")

diff --git a/arch/sparc/mm/srmmu.c b/arch/sparc/mm/srmmu.c
index 869023a..769bf7f 100644
--- a/arch/sparc/mm/srmmu.c
+++ b/arch/sparc/mm/srmmu.c
@@ -458,10 +458,12 @@  static void __init sparc_context_init(int numctx)
 void switch_mm(struct mm_struct *old_mm, struct mm_struct *mm,
 	       struct task_struct *tsk)
 {
+	unsigned long flags;
+
 	if (mm->context == NO_CONTEXT) {
-		spin_lock(&srmmu_context_spinlock);
+		spin_lock_irqsave(&srmmu_context_spinlock, flags);
 		alloc_context(old_mm, mm);
-		spin_unlock(&srmmu_context_spinlock);
+		spin_unlock_irqrestore(&srmmu_context_spinlock, flags);
 		srmmu_ctxd_set(&srmmu_context_table[mm->context], mm->pgd);
 	}
 
@@ -986,14 +988,15 @@  int init_new_context(struct task_struct *tsk, struct mm_struct *mm)
 
 void destroy_context(struct mm_struct *mm)
 {
+	unsigned long flags;
 
 	if (mm->context != NO_CONTEXT) {
 		flush_cache_mm(mm);
 		srmmu_ctxd_set(&srmmu_context_table[mm->context], srmmu_swapper_pg_dir);
 		flush_tlb_mm(mm);
-		spin_lock(&srmmu_context_spinlock);
+		spin_lock_irqsave(&srmmu_context_spinlock, flags);
 		free_context(mm->context);
-		spin_unlock(&srmmu_context_spinlock);
+		spin_unlock_irqrestore(&srmmu_context_spinlock, flags);
 		mm->context = NO_CONTEXT;
 	}
 }
